What to wear to a summer picnic

I am heading out, albeit very late, to a huge summer picnic.  I plan to eat lots so as I thought about my strategy for getting dressed, I thought I would share it with you too:

1.  Separates and layers — I would never wear a romper to a summer picnic because if I spill something, I have ruined the entire outfit.  Instead, I choose separates — easy shorts or skirts and tops.  Yes, tops plural.  I like to layer a little so if I spill something, I can take off a top and still have a clean outfit on.  Now you can do this by carrying an extra top too.  (P.S.  Great idea for kids too.)

2.  Comfortable shoes — this isn’t the time to show off how you can walk in 5 inch heels.  Comfort is key.  Wedges are great and so are…am I really saying this…flip flops.

3.  Crossbody bag — if you have got to carry a bag make sure it is easy to handle and leaves your hands free.  How else will you balance your plate and drink?
